He was born at Frankfurt am Main in 1789, where he received his early artistic education.
He soon became noted as a landscape painter and made various journeys throughout Austria and Italy, painting, as he went along, views in the neighborhood of the Danube and in the city of Vienna.
[1] In later life Alt painted a lot in watercolor; he was also a lithographer.
[1] In 1830 the future Emperor Ferdinand I of Austria began a project to commission paintings of the most beautiful views in the Empire.
[2] Alt's extensive herbarium is now in the Lower Austrian State Museum .
